If I had a million dollars (and no other obligations)

Since I have an insatiable thirst for seeing new places, I would be torn between seeing as many places as possible, and staying in a few places for a longer period of time.

In the end, however, I believe the latter would win my internal-instinct vote, and I would choose a few places to focus my efforts.

I would begin in Bali, a place I have been before and therefore am slightly comfortable. I am already interested in teaching English in Southeast Asia, and so would spend 20 or more hours a week teaching either wee-kids (aged 6-8) or middle-aged adults. On the weekends and during my free time I would focus my efforts on the sea-life in the area and their preservation. I went snorkeling on my short trip to Bali, and the water was filled with trash and the reef was obviously suffering. Even something as simple as cleaning up the beaches of Bali would make a big difference.

After living and working in Bali for 6 months to a year I would move on to Africa. Ideally I would do shark research and preservation in South Africa. I would research great whites around seal-island. Eventually, after a few months, I would migrate north and work in a community building schools and teaching in Tanzania or Zimbabwe.

After working on schools and getting involved in the community (learning about the local customs, etc) I would fly over to South or Central America to do more ocean/wildlife research. I would work with sea turtle preservation.

The entire time I am abroad I would chronicle my travels with journal-writing and picture taking. Also, I would immerse myself in the culture and try to eat as many interesting and cultural foods as possible.

Upon returning home, I would travel throughout my own community, trying to recruit people to volunteer as well. For those that cannot afford volunteer vacations, I would organize fundraisers in order to send those who are motivated on a once-in-a-lifetime traveling/volunteering experience. With education and fund raising, hopefully the cycle would continue and anyone, regardless of financial status, would be able to partake in the program.
